Cigarette lighter scocket doesn't work

I have changed the fuse and changed socket with an orginal socket from Ford. Still does not work. Help.

Re: Cigarette lighter scocket doesn't work

Doe's your Data Link Connector (DLC) work for a scanner?
Did the fuse blow?

Usually the DLC & cigar lighter are connected to the same fuse.
Maybe there's a bent pin in the DLC connector.

Re: Cigarette lighter scocket doesn't work

Pull the fuse and check for voltage at the block. If voltage, borrow someone else's lighter and stick it in your new socket to verify it's not the actual element that's bad (you mentioned a new socket, not a new element). If the working lighter doesn't work in your car, and you have voltage from the fuse block, trace the lighter wire and verify continuity.
